Computer Programming
South Puget Sound Community College · Olympia, WA
Students in the Computer Programming program at South Puget Sound Community College pursue an Associate degree. Graduates earn a median salary of $44,890 four years after completion, compared to a national median of $55,656 for Computer Programming programs. Graduates typically enter roles like Software Developers, Software Quality Assurance Analysts and Testers, and Computer Programmers. The median salary for Software Developers is $132,270. Approximately 13 students completed this program in the most recent reporting year.
